Global Trends: The Robotics and AI Talent Boom

By 2030, the global market for robotics professionals is projected to more than double. According to the International Federation of Robotics, industrial robot installations have already surpassed 500,000 units annually. Combine that with the exponential growth of AI applications, and you get a job market evolving faster than ever before.

What drives this demand? Let’s break it down:

  • Automation of traditional industries — Manufacturing, logistics, and agriculture are rapidly adopting collaborative robots (cobots), requiring engineers, AI developers, and integration specialists.
  • Emergence of service robotics — Healthcare, hospitality, and retail are seeing a surge in robotics for assistance, delivery, and customer interaction, fueling demand for AI and robotics UX experts.
  • AI-powered analytics and decision-making — Businesses seek data scientists and AI specialists to extract actionable insights from sensor-rich robotic platforms.

“The World Economic Forum predicts that by 2025, automation and a new division of labor between humans, machines and algorithms could displace 85 million jobs, while creating 97 million new ones—many directly tied to robotics and AI.”

Regional Spotlights: Who’s Leading the Race?

Region Key Robotics Sectors Demand Forecast (2030)
Asia-Pacific Manufacturing, Logistics, Smart Cities Highest global demand for robotics engineers and integration specialists
North America Healthcare, Autonomous Vehicles, AI Research Surging need for AI developers and robotics software architects
Europe Industrial Automation, Green Tech, AgriTech Strong growth in robotics systems designers and safety experts
Middle East & Africa Infrastructure, Energy, Security Emerging opportunities for robotics deployment specialists

Asia-Pacific, spearheaded by China, Japan, and South Korea, will continue to be the powerhouse of robotics deployment, but talent shortages are pushing companies to recruit globally. North America and Europe are racing ahead in AI-driven robotics, especially in autonomous vehicles and healthcare robotics. Regional differences mean unique opportunities—knowing where your expertise is in highest demand is key.

Roles on the Rise: Skills That Shape the Future

  • Robotics Software Engineer: Mastery of C++, Python, ROS, and simulation tools like Gazebo or Webots is becoming essential.
  • AI/ML Engineer for Robotics: Deep learning, reinforcement learning, and real-time sensor data processing are hot skills.
  • Robotics Integration Specialist: Bridging hardware, software, and cloud—think edge AI, IoT, and digital twins.
  • Human-Robot Interaction (HRI) Designer: Combining psychology, design, and engineering for seamless collaboration.
  • Ethics & Safety Officer: As robots take on critical roles, specialists in AI ethics, safety, and compliance are increasingly sought after.

The future isn’t just about coding clever robots—it’s about building systems that are safe, trustworthy, and impactful in real-world environments.

Practical Scenarios: How Robotics Talent Transforms Industries

Let’s take healthcare as an example. Surgical robots demand a fusion of mechanical engineers, control systems experts, and ML researchers. But that’s just the start—maintenance teams, data analysts, and even robot empathy trainers are being hired. In warehouses, swarm robotics engineers are needed to coordinate fleets of mobile robots. And in agriculture, specialists develop AI-powered drones and autonomous tractors to optimize yields and reduce environmental impact.

“A single autonomous vehicle program can employ hundreds of robotics and AI professionals, from perception experts to simulation modelers and cybersecurity analysts.”

Why Modern Approaches Matter: Templates, Frameworks, and Ecosystems

Gone are the days when every robotics project started from scratch. Today, using structured templates, open-source frameworks like ROS 2, and cloud-based simulation platforms accelerates both learning and deployment. The ability to quickly prototype, test, and scale solutions is not just a technical benefit—it’s a competitive necessity. Businesses leveraging these tools reduce time-to-market and minimize costly errors.

For aspiring professionals, mastering these modern toolkits and keeping up with evolving standards is a career superpower. For companies, building on established templates means fewer pitfalls and more reliable launches.

Advice for the Next Decade: Preparing for the Robotics Job Market

  • Learn continuously: The field evolves rapidly. Online courses, open-source contributions, and hackathons are invaluable.
  • Build multidisciplinary teams: Robotics thrives at the intersection of hardware, software, AI, and human factors.
  • Embrace real-world projects: Employers value hands-on experience and demonstrable results over theoretical knowledge.
  • Stay ethical and responsible: Robots touch lives—understanding the impact of your work is essential.
